The J1772 vs Type 2 EV charger connector question is one of the first things every new EV owner needs to understand — and one of the last things most dealerships bother to explain. J1772 is the standard AC charging connector across the US and Canada. Type 2 is the equivalent across Europe. They are not compatible with each other, they charge at different speeds, and the NACS transition in the US has added a new layer of complexity that most guides haven’t caught up with yet.
